With Meredith and Derek's relationship a known commodity
among the interns (not to mention Bailey), Derek has been spending almost
every night at Meredith's, and everyone seems pretty comfortable with that -
except for Meredith. She realizes she knows precious little about Derek. But
Derek isn't in a very telling mood.
Izzie makes some brownies, but despite George's adoration, they just don't
taste right to her. But she refuses to call the person who gave her the
recipe to find out what's missing, because that person is her mom.
Cristina is pregnant, but doesn't want to be for much
longer. She schedules an appointment at a clinic to terminate the pregnancy.
At the hospital, Alex and Burke work on a case of a teenaged girl in need of
a new heart valve. Standard procedure is to install a porcine valve. But
this girl's interpretation of her own religious beliefs preclude any pig
products from entering her body in any way. She refuses the valve.
Cristina is assigned to work on a case of a man with seizures he believes
are really psychic visions. He predicts that a patient will die on the
fourth floor. Moments later, one does. But fourth floor is the ICU, and our
interns aren't that impressed, as patients die all the time on that floor.
Cristina skepticism is put to the limits, though, when the psychic makes a
comment about her being "on the mommy track." Cristina requests to
be moved off the case, but Bailey doesn't do switches. Izzie, though, really
wants on the psychic case - to prove he's a fraud. So they do wind up
switching, and Cristina winds up on Izzie's case - a woman with breast
cancer. But the treatment for the cancer is complicated by the fact that
she's pregnant (there's no way the fetus can survive the cancer treatments).
Cristina just can't escape the issue of pregnancy...
Meredith works with Derek on a rock climber with paralysis that's spreading
up his body. All tests show nothing physical as the cause though. So
Meredith believes it may be psychosomatic.
Alex does some research on his own and finds that a bovine valve is not only
an alternative to a porcine valve, but also better in the long run. But he
suggests this option to his patient and her family without consulting with
Burke first. Burke isn't happy about that. He's never implanted a bovine
valve, as it's a much newer, vastly more complicated surgery. He kicks Alex
off another case.
Izzie challenges the psychic's "gift." And when she discovers that
he has an embolism that could pop during his next seizure and kill him,
she's all too eager to sign him up for surgery. The psychic doesn't want the
surgery, though. He's worried it could take away his gift. Izzie isn't
sympathetic. Her mother, it turns out, blew Izzie's entire savings (for
college) on psychics, hence the their non-existent relationship today.
The rock climber's paralysis is worsening, so Derek decides to go with his
instinct and open up the man's spine and look for a clot. Meredith strongly
disagrees - it's all in his head, any surgery on the spine could make things
worse, even kill him. But it's Derek's call and they're doing it anyway.
George has issues doing a relatively simple intubation in front of Alex and
Burke. His confidence is shot. Cristina suggests he ask out a cute nurse
that's been eyeing him.
Burke admits to Cristina that he's unsure of what to do about the bovine
transplant. The family wants it, but he's never done one before. She's not
sympathetic, telling him that "your problem has a solution. Some
don't."
After some tense moments, Derek finds the clot that he believed was there,
but Meredith didn't. Burke asks Alex back on the case to assist with the
bovine valve transplant that he's going to perform. Against Cristina's
advice, her cancer patient with pregnancy decides to forgo any treatment for
the breast cancer so that her baby can go full term. George finally nails an
intubation - in front of the nurse, Olivia, that's been eyeing him. He asks
her out. The psychic tells Izzie some things no one could know but her, and
she too becomes worried that the surgery might change him. But when he comes
out, he tells her something that proves he's still got whatever gift he had:
her missing ingredient. After making another batch of brownies that taste
just right, she gives her estranged mother a call...
